From 858af91d38a9f6673e5068f263094a1a767aef2e Mon Sep 17 00:00:00 2001 From: Sebastian Schildt Date: Wed, 16 Oct 2024 12:59:08 +0200 Subject: [PATCH] Update Signed-off-by: Sebastian Schildt --- kuksa-persistence-provider/src/kuksaconnector.rs | 7 +++++++ kuksa-persistence-provider/statestore.json | 9 +++++++++ 2 files changed, 16 insertions(+) create mode 100644 kuksa-persistence-provider/src/kuksaconnector.rs create mode 100644 kuksa-persistence-provider/statestore.json diff --git a/kuksa-persistence-provider/src/kuksaconnector.rs b/kuksa-persistence-provider/src/kuksaconnector.rs new file mode 100644 index 0000000..7440efc --- /dev/null +++ b/kuksa-persistence-provider/src/kuksaconnector.rs @@ -0,0 +1,7 @@ +use crate::storage; + +pub fn get_from_storage_and_set(storage: &impl storage::Storage, vsspath: &str) { + let value = storage.get(vsspath); + println!("Got from storage: {}: {}", value,value); +} + diff --git a/kuksa-persistence-provider/statestore.json b/kuksa-persistence-provider/statestore.json new file mode 100644 index 0000000..4e66b85 --- /dev/null +++ b/kuksa-persistence-provider/statestore.json @@ -0,0 +1,9 @@ + +{ + "Vehicle.VehicleIdentification.VIN": { + "value": "DEADBEEF" + }, + "Vehicle.VehicleIdentification.VehicleInteriorColor": { + "value": "Black" + } +} \ No newline at end of file